The Uzbek Police have confirmed the arrest of six Cameroonians who were reportedly caught trafficking counterfeit banknotes amounting to at least 10 Million Dollars.
The information was relayed to the Ministry of External Relations in Cameroon via correspondence from the Delegate in Charge of Home Affairs at the Cameroon Embassy in Russia, Florence Effa on February 18, 2021.
In the correspondence sent to External Relations Minister, Le Jeune Mbella Mbella, it also specified that these Cameroonians who have not yet been individually identified were presented on Uzbekistan National Television that same day of the arrest.
It should be noted that this is not the first time that Cameroonians have been arrested in this country over counterfeiting. In 2019, five other Cameroonians were equally arrested in Uzbekistan, detained, judged, and charged over counterfeiting and fraud of money worth over 340, 000 USD.
